Paragon Wireless dual mode mobile phone user’s manual Page 59
Chapter 11. Camera
You can use the “Camera” application to take pictures anytime, anywhere. The Pictures are
automatically stored in the Photos application. You can rename the Pictures in the application, send
the Pictures using MMS, or email the pictures stored on the phone
Note: JPEG is a standard image compression format. The file extension for the JPEG file is JPG.
Note:
To ensure the transfer speed of the MMS, your mobile service provider may impose a limit on
the size of the message. Please contact your service provider for details.
11.1 Taking photos
Note: Please follow the appropriate local regulations on taking pictures.
1. Click “camera” to start the application. You will see the view window and its frames. The
area within the frame is the image area. When display an image in the view window, the
image will resize to fit the size of the screen. When displayed on the computer screen, the
image may be of higher resolution. The effective area of the lens is 30 cm. If the distance
between the object being captured and the lens is less than 30cm, the clarity of the image
may be affected (A flash image is omitted).

2. Click the shutter button on the bottom of the screen or the side camera button to shoot
directly.
3. Click the drop down menu:
Select Photo Quality: Click the icon to change the quality of the photo. The quality
you can choose from includes high, middle and low.
Select Rotate: You can also set the angle to rotate from 0 degrees to 180 degrees.
Select Self timer countdown: You can configure the self-timer to shot a picture with a
delay of 5, 10, or 15 seconds after pressing the Capture button.
Select Consecutive num: You can select the number of photos to take continuously
from 3, 6, 9 and 18.
Select Shutter sound: There are three shutter sounds to choose from. You can also
select Mute.
After you have finished taking pictures click the save on the bottom left of the screen and
save the photo in the Photos.
